The New Era of Personalized Finance: Embracing Tech for Tailored Wealth Strategies

Date:

As technology becomes more sophisticated, so does user demand. Case in point, today’s investors expect technology to be specifically tailored to their unique wealth strategies. As a result, the dawn of a new era in finance is upon us, with the emphasis firmly on personalization. It is a revolution that is redefining wealth management for the modern investor. This transformation is not just about the adoption of technology. It is about leveraging it to reflect individual investors’ needs and goals.

At the forefront of this transformation are innovative firms like G1 Capital Partners, which have recognized that the one-size-fits-all approach of the past is no longer sufficient. These pioneers are leveraging the power of big data, artificial intelligence (AI), and an intricate understanding of individual investor profiles to craft strategies that are as unique as the clients themselves.

The fusion of technology and personalized finance is not just a trend. It reflects how one can synthesize data into insights directly impacting financial decision-making. AI algorithms can now analyze vast amounts of information, including market trends, economic indicators, and personal financial data, to identify opportunities and risks tailored to specific investment profiles. This capacity for nuanced analysis allows for developing financial plans that align closely with an investor’s long-term objectives and risk tolerance.




Moreover, the integration of technology into finance serves a dual purpose. It enhances the precision of investment strategies and elevates the client experience. Through secure online platforms, investors can now enjoy real-time access to their portfolios, enabling them to monitor progress and adjust their strategies in partnership with their financial advisors. This immediacy and transparency foster a more profound sense of control and involvement in one’s financial journey.

However, technology’s role extends beyond just data processing and user interfaces. Innovations like blockchain and smart contracts are introducing new levels of security and efficiency to transactions. Meanwhile, robo-advisors are making wealth management services more accessible, offering algorithm-based recommendations for those with less complex financial situations.

Yet, amidst this technological revolution, the value of human insight remains irreplaceable. Firms such as G1 Capital Partners understand that technology is a tool to enhance, not replace, the expertise of skilled financial advisors. The human element is critical in interpreting data within the context of an investor’s life story, aspirations, and concerns. The synergy between cutting-edge technology and human expertise truly defines the new era of personalized finance.

This approach to wealth management also acknowledges the evolving financial landscape and the diverse needs of different generations. Millennials and Gen Z investors, for instance, often seek investment options aligning with their social and environmental values. Personalized finance, powered by technology, enables the creation of portfolios that meet financial goals and contribute to the greater good.

The financial industry’s pivot towards personalized strategies represents more than a technological upgrade. It signifies a fundamental reimagining of wealth management. The convergence of AI, big data, and human expertise enables firms to design financial plans that can be as individual as a fingerprint. This new standard in wealth management promises to enhance individuals’ wealth and enrich the financial industry with innovation and inclusivity.
